South Fulton, Georgia launched a food truck program to deliver more variety of cuisine to the area. In particular, officials want to provide affordable, nutritious food to the area, according to a report by WSB-TV 2.
Officials said this program will provide, "diverse cuisine directly to current city employees and those working in adjacent and surrounding businesses. The new food truck program is designed to tackle the challenge of finding accessible and viable food options head-on."
The city will partner with local food truck operators to offer a rotating schedule of food trucks.
"This approach not only provides culinary convenience and affordable alternatives to the gas station and fast food sources found within reach but also helps in fostering a healthier lifestyle for participants. The program does more than just alleviate food scarcity; it also stimulates local commerce, strengthens community ties and provides wellness opportunities for those involved through stepping away from the desk, walking outside, getting fresh air and communing with others," the city wrote in a statement.
